Technics' signature direct-drive technology and robust torque combine with tremendous convenience in the SL-50C turntable, an analog package designed for modern lifestyles and easy usability. Complete with a built-in MM phono preamplifier, Ortofon 2M Red cartridge, and aluminum S-shaped tonearm with an enhanced tonearm base with a plain bearing system, SL-50C does the work for you. Plus, its compact 5.0 x 16.9 x 13.9-inch (HWD) size means it fits in places many high-end decks cannot.

Offering 33, 45, and 78RPM speed accessible via a control panel on the lower left corner of the MDF plinth that also handles start/stop functions, SL-50C includes a 2.78-pound die-cast aluminum platter with reinforced ribs and a directly mounted motor magnet for excellent stability, rigidity, and precision. It works in conjunction with the same 12-pole, 9-coil, three-phase, coreless, brushless direct-drive motor implemented in Technics' high-end SL-1500C and SL-1200 MK7 models. The result: high rotational accuracy and exceptional signal-to-noise ratio. You'll also get minimized cogging thanks to the presence of stators that don't use iron core. A rotor yoke that prevents magnetic flux leakage adds to the audiophile-minded touches.

Inside, a high-grade equalizer circuit housed in a shielded case helps eliminate external noise. The separate PCBs for power, motor control, and phono EQ are placed away from the tonearm with crossover-free wiring to minimize distortion. SL-50C leverages digital control to deliver rotation accuracy via precise speed detection and optimized motor-drive signals. On the bottom of the plinth, newly designed insulators — complete with rubber and the SL-1200 MK7 housing, spring, and cushion — provide excellent vibration resistance.

Able to start up in just 0.7 seconds at 33RPM, and completed with a stainless-steel center shaft and thrust bearing with steel balls, SL-50C plays LPs with smooth, lively, and accurate sound. Technics' decades of experience with turntables and trickle-down technology help make this rig a delight.

Technics did not need to wait years before developing SC-CX700, its first-ever wireless bookshelf speaker system. Yet the company wanted to ensure it harbored the same extraordinary levels of performance, technology, and build quality as its audiophile turntables. Spend even a few minutes with SC-CX700, and you’ll likely agree Technics achieved its goals. 

Leveraging the advanced engineering found in wired speakers, amplifiers, and signal processing devices, SC-CX700 stands as an integrated solution that plays back sound with exquisite detail and harmony — all the while offering you the convenience and clutter-free appearance that come with wireless speakers.

Adhering to the principle of acoustic solitude construction, the amplifier and speaker boxes in SC-CX700 have separate structures and spacing, thereby minimizing vibration transmission and increasing clarity. Each speaker also claims its own JENO engine to reduce signal transmission disturbance and increase the faithfulness of what reaches your ears. Another cutting-edge technology, Technics’ model-based diaphragm control (MBDC) lessens harmonic distortion, leading to superb separation and imaging characteristics. 

Compatible with Apple AirPlay and Google Cast, and able to play music from streaming services, vinyl LPs (thanks to a built-in MM phonostage), a TV, and more, SC-CX700 can be easily controlled via an app, remote, or the control panel on the main unit. Three trademarked SpaceTune functions allow to fine-to the sound to best suit your environment. And yes, SC-CX700 will turn heads no matter where you place it. Wrapped in microfiber material featuring a suede-like texture called Dinamica, SC-CX700 is hands-down one of the most elegant and eye-pleasing wireless models on the market.
